For the majority of women, ultrasound shows that the child is expanding usually. If your ultrasound is typical, just be sure to maintain going to your prenatal examinations. In some cases, ultrasound may show that you and your child need unique treatment. If the ultrasound reveals your infant has spina bifida, he might be dealt with in the womb prior to birth.
A c-section is surgical treatment in which your child is born via a cut that your medical professional makes in your stomach and uterus. The standard 2D ultrasound creates flat and laid out photos which can be utilized to see your baby's interior body organs and help find any type of inner concerns. These black and white photos aid the sonographer determine the child's gestation, growth, heart beat, advancement and size. Some pregnant mommies select to have a 3D ultrasound check due to the fact that they show more of a real-life photo of the baby.

3D ultrasound scans show still images of your infant's external body instead than their insides, so you can see the shape of the child's face features. 4D ultrasound scans are similar to 3D scans but they show a relocating video instead of still pictures. This catches highlights and shadows better, as a result developing a clearer picture of the infant's face and movements.

A prenatal ultrasound check is an analysis strategy that uses high-frequency sound waves to produce an image of your fetus. Ultrasounds might be executed at numerous times throughout maternity for different reasons. The test can supply beneficial info, aiding women and their health-care providers take care of and look after the pregnancy and the fetus.
